> 	On a system now running:
>
> 14.0-CURRENT FreeBSD 14.0-CURRENT #0 main-d6327ae8c1: Sun Jan 24
> 14:16:54 EST 2021 amd64
>
> 	(src+ports updated at midnight US EST)
> 	with PORTS_MODULES="drm-current-kmod gpu-firmware-kmod", starting
> the system _without_ loading drm results in a usable system.
> 	Loading drm - whether via kldlist in rc.conf or by kldload at the
> console immediately after start-up - instantly crashes the system; the
> screen goes blank and the lights on the monitor report no signal
> from the system.
> 	There is nothing in dmesg.boot.
> 	In messages I find (75 lines follow):

> 	The GPU is a Radeon HD 3300, and at one point this used to work.
> 	Help, please?
>
     The x11 team's opinion appears to be that a Radeon HD 5770 is too old to be
supported, so a Radeon HD 3300, being considerably older, likely falls under that
same opinion.  See PR #247441.
